Hello everyone
Had anyone had luck removing a flap servo without wrecking the surrounding foam. Or any tips? One of my flap servos center point is noticeably different from the other, I’d like to keep using the board rather than plus in one separate servo on the Rx, so I’v currently put a mix in. But I’d like to get it out and re centre the horn.Comment
-
Are you 1/2 a cog or a full cog out. If its 1/2 a cog it wont help to take it out and re centre it as you will be 1/2 a cog out the other way . You could use a very sharp new hobby knife blade and cut a v into the foam so that you can get to the screw that holds the servo horn in place, remove and re-fix the horn, then glue back the foam V you cut out. If the mix works I don`t see the point of re centering as long as the flaps drop equal amounts on both half and full. But I suppose if it bugs you then by all means go ahead!!! I have removed a servo before now by sliding a hobby knife down the sides of the servo to ensure the sides and lugs are free before attempting to pull the servo out using pliers to grip the servo horn and teasing it free, just dont cut the servo wires with the knifeHello everyone

If all I need to do is move the arm on the splines, I do what Evan said.
If I really need to remove a servo because it has failed, I run a hobby knife around the edges (avoiding the leads) and I hook a paint can opener under the body of the servo and pull it out. The adhesive is kind of gummy and will give fairly easily.Comment

I have recently ordered a Avanti, I would like to paint the canopy blue like the one in the product photos. What colour of blue is it? And can I paint the tinted canopy without much difference in the shade of the blue or should I get the clear canopy and paint that?Comment
-
I doubt you will match the shade of blue perfectly because it depends on the thickness of paint and number of layers you use. Whatever shade you go with start with the clear canopy, if you try to do a transparent blue over a transparent bronze/brown it just wont work. Have you painted a canopy before?, if not then forgive me for stating the obvious but paint from the inside and go with light multiple coats so that you can stop when you are happy
